Paintball - World Cup Asia 2009



Did you know that Kuala Lumpur has hosted the World Cup Asia - the largest paintball event in Asia - five times? This year, 120 teams have registered to compete; these teams come from France, UK, US, Guam, UAE, Iran, Australia, Japan, Indonesia, Philippines, Singapore, India, and Malaysia. There's even a waiting list, man.

Held at the Xtion Paintball Park at Kompleks Sukan Negara, Bukit Jalil, this year's tournament will take place from 19 - 22 November 2009. With international press in tow (ESPN has broadcasted the competition) and sweet cash prizes (ahem, US$10,000 for Division 1 winners!!), you can be assured of some good ol' competition.

There's more going on of course, like exhibitions, workshops, games, clinics, etc. To get the full details on that, visit their official website here.They are also the founder and organisers of the Paintball Asia League Series (PALS) since 2005 where events have been held in Thailand,Taiwan and the Philippines. The jewel of PALS remains till today, the World Cup Asia (WCA).


Malaysia's first paintball league, Malaysia Paintball Official Circuit (MPOC), was first organised by us since 2004. Malaysia oldest league is now into its' 5th year and on the verge of turning a very important corner. Five legs are held every year.

Paintball Field Position




As a new paintball team, we had lot of problems handling things like: where we should go and what position we should play in. Through practice we discovered the best field positions (amature level).

For example, in a seven man paintball match, it is vital for you to play 3 front 4 back style. This means that there should should be cross shooting all the time. As a new team we were told to play 4 in front and 3 in back. But we soon discovered that this will put more pressure on the front players since their survival is crucial. It also exposed more of our front to the enemy than we thought.

In any paintball game the snake is a vital aspect. The guy who has both speed and good reflexes should play it.

Next, the middle guy, he should have good vision on what is going on in both sides of the field (left and right). This does not mean that he will have to expose himself in order to do so, but he should know whats going on on both sides.

Next is the guy in the corner (he is like the snake guy), and should be really fast and should have good reflexes, or they will be shot in the break.

Good aim is very necessary in paintball, and it is also very important for you to shoot from the word go. I mean, not the guys who are running to the front, but the other 4 people should start shooting at the opposite bunkers, like the enemy entrance of the snake and the other corners. This will prevent the enemy from getting to those paintball bunkers at the start, and this will give your front men more space to advance into enemy territory, and the even shoot off enemies with ease.
